From: Chris Hanson Date: Thu, 5 Jan 1995 23:30:55 +0000 (+0000) Subject: Change to use static linking. Add support for subprocesses. Delete X-Git-Tag: 20090517-FFI~6835 X-Git-Url: https://birchwood-abbey.net/git?a=commitdiff_plain;h=d5b2ff2eacd64d347b39e755432e2a50d41b0590;p=mit-scheme.git Change to use static linking. Add support for subprocesses. Delete "os2api.c". --- diff --git a/v7/src/microcode/os2utl/makefile b/v7/src/microcode/os2utl/makefile index 2de71a89f..1b65103e2 100644 --- a/v7/src/microcode/os2utl/makefile +++ b/v7/src/microcode/os2utl/makefile @@ -1,8 +1,8 @@ ### -*- Fundamental -*- ### -### $Id: makefile,v 1.3 1994/12/19 22:32:49 cph Exp $ +### $Id: makefile,v 1.4 1995/01/05 23:30:55 cph Exp $ ### -### Copyright (c) 1994 Massachusetts Institute of Technology +### Copyright (c) 1994-95 Massachusetts Institute of Technology ### ### This material was developed by the Scheme project at the ### Massachusetts Institute of Technology, Department of @@ -66,7 +66,7 @@ USER_PRIM_OBJECTS = USER_LIBS = CC = icc -ICC_FLAGS = /Gd+ /Gm+ /Q+ +ICC_FLAGS = /Gd- /Gm+ /Q+ DEBUG_CFLAGS = /Ti+ /O- /Oi- /Debug OPTIMIZE_CFLAGS = /O CFLAGS = -DMIT_SCHEME -D__STDC__ $(DEBUG_CFLAGS) $(ICC_FLAGS) @@ -231,12 +231,12 @@ prosenv.c \ prosfile.c \ prosfs.c \ prosio.c \ +prosproc.c \ prosterm.c \ prostty.c \ pros2fs.c \ pros2io.c \ pros2pm.c -# prosproc.c # prospty.c OS_PRIM_OBJECTS = \ @@ -244,17 +244,16 @@ prosenv.$(OBJ) \ prosfile.$(OBJ) \ prosfs.$(OBJ) \ prosio.$(OBJ) \ +prosproc.$(OBJ) \ prosterm.$(OBJ) \ prostty.$(OBJ) \ pros2fs.$(OBJ) \ pros2io.$(OBJ) \ pros2pm.$(OBJ) -#prosproc.$(OBJ) #prospty.$(OBJ) OS2_SOURCES = \ os2.c \ -os2api.c \ os2conio.c \ os2cthrd.c \ os2ctty.c \ @@ -266,6 +265,7 @@ os2msg.c \ os2pipe.c \ os2pm.c \ os2pmcon.c \ +os2proc.c \ os2term.c \ os2thrd.c \ os2top.c \ @@ -274,7 +274,6 @@ os2xcpt.c OS2_OBJECTS = \ os2.$(OBJ) \ -os2api.$(OBJ) \ os2conio.$(OBJ) \ os2cthrd.$(OBJ) \ os2ctty.$(OBJ) \ @@ -286,6 +285,7 @@ os2msg.$(OBJ) \ os2pipe.$(OBJ) \ os2pm.$(OBJ) \ os2pmcon.$(OBJ) \ +os2proc.$(OBJ) \ os2term.$(OBJ) \ os2thrd.$(OBJ) \ os2top.$(OBJ) \ @@ -429,7 +429,7 @@ prosenv.$(OBJ) : osenv.h ostop.h prosfile.$(OBJ) : osfile.h prosfs.$(OBJ) : osfs.h prosio.$(OBJ) : osio.h -#prosproc.$(OBJ) : osproc.h +prosproc.$(OBJ) : osproc.h #prospty.$(OBJ) : osterm.h osio.h ospty.h prosterm.$(OBJ) : osterm.h osio.h prostty.$(OBJ) : ostty.h osctty.h osfile.h osio.h @@ -443,6 +443,7 @@ os2ctty.$(OBJ) : osctty.h ossig.h os2env.$(OBJ) : scheme.tch osenv.h os2file.$(OBJ) : osfile.h os2fs.$(OBJ) : osfs.h +os2proc.$(OBJ) : osproc.h os2top.$(OBJ) : ostop.h option.h os2tty.$(OBJ) : ostty.h os2xcpt.$(OBJ) : scheme.tch $(GC_HEAD_FILES)